Céline Orvain is a scholar working on Molecular Biology, Insect Science and Ecology. According to data from OpenAlex, Céline Orvain has authored 4 papers receiving a total of 127 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 2 papers in Molecular Biology, 2 papers in Insect Science and 1 paper in Ecology. Recurrent topics in Céline Orvain’s work include Insect symbiosis and bacterial influences (2 papers), Plant and animal studies (1 paper) and Coral and Marine Ecosystems Studies (1 paper). Céline Orvain is often cited by papers focused on Insect symbiosis and bacterial influences (2 papers), Plant and animal studies (1 paper) and Coral and Marine Ecosystems Studies (1 paper). Céline Orvain collaborates with scholars based in France. Céline Orvain's co-authors include Corinne Cruaud, Emmanuelle Jousselin, Anne‐Laure Clamens, Alejandro Manzano‐Marín, Armelle Cœur d’Acier, Valérie Barbe, Caroline Belser, Corinne Da Silva, Laurène Giraut and Laura Briñas and has published in prestigious journals such as The ISME Journal, BMC Genomics and Genome Biology and Evolution.
